Q: When it comes to bodysuits, I am used to seeing them as lingerie.  I even had several myself that had hooks at the bottom.  Those were my weapons of seduction.  But now I am seeing some that resemble swimsuits for dance or gymnastics without any hooks in the panty portion.  I wonder, what are they for?  

Yes, bodysuits can mean different things for different people. I guess the most common form is the lingerie kind, and yes those generally have the crotch fastenings. At the moment there are also a whole range of bodysuits that are designed to be worn as its own piece of clothing; similar to the way you would wear a top. You are right, these don’t always have the crotch hooks. I would say there are two categories of bodysuits; shapewear (or underwear) bodysuits and fashion bodysuits. Here, I’ll explain a bit about each one and why I like wearing them. Bodysuits can feel really great to wear.

Underwear 

I love wearing a nice tight bodysuit as underwear. This kind generally falls in the category of shapewear.  As one Youtube model named Christina says, shapewear is like pantyhose for your body.

I would split underwear, or shapewear, bodysuits into two different types of thong bottom and normal bottom.  Most bodysuits, especially the shapewear ones come with a hook-fastening crotch which makes it more accessible in the crotch area.


Thong bodysuits 

Thongs are really comfortable. They are nice and tight around the crotch. And with the thong resting firmly in-between the butt cheeks, they can make for a sexy feeling!  The only downside I find is if I’m in a work environment and I’m wearing jeans, sometimes I worry about my shirt rising up to reveal the fact that I’m wearing a thong.  Some situations I don’t mind if people see, other environments it’s not so appropriate.  If I wear a thong bodysuit to work or such places, I make sure I’m wearing a shirt that won’t ride up and bottoms that won’t ride down.  Leggings are perfect to wear with thong bodysuits I find as they give my bum a really good shape with no visible panty lines. Also thong bodysuits are great to wear with skirts (pencil skirts or miniskirts) and pantyhose.  I usually wear the bodysuit over the top of my pantyhose.

One of my thong bodysuits is from Vedette.  It has latex in the body of it so it is really tight. It gives a great hourglass shape to my body. The only downside is that it’s quite thick material and is quite hot, and it gets too hot to wear in summer. It’s definitely a winter bodysuit. Spanx also so a great thong bodysuit in a thinner material.

Full bottom bodysuits 

Full bottom bodysuits are great too. I usually wear these when I’m in a place where I don’t want my thong to show, or when I just don’t feel like wearing a thong. I like the full support feeling around my bum. You don’t get this feeling with the thong bodysuit. You can either go for a lingerie kind of look with under wire, and some might come with corset shaping in the body. The ones with the under wire are handy because it is basically and bra and panties in one. They also usually have a hook-fastening on the crotch.

Balera Body Suit – another item in Amber’s wardrobe

Another kind is more of a ballet, leotard style.  I’ve actually just bought this Balera bodysuit online.  It has its own built in shelf bra which can be handy. I wear this one under jeans, tights, skirts or leggings.  I wear tight fitting shirts or singlets over it. I might wear it on its own if I find the right bottoms to go with it, but it is generally an undergarment so should really be hidden from view.  This is also a great bodysuit to wear as underwear when exercising, or any active situations.

All of these bodysuits are great to wear as underwear.  I love the tight, sexy feeling they give, especially the shapewear bodysuits.  And, because they are worn as underwear, under clothes, nobody necessarily knows you are wearing this tight, snuggly undergarment!

Fashion 

Another kind of bodysuit is the fashion bodysuit. These are generally worn as you would a top. So generally nothing goes over the top of them.

I have just bought this particular bodysuit from Black Milk.  They have a wonderful range of bodysuits in all sorts of different prints and styles.  They even do a hooded bodysuit!! It’s super sexy.  They actually call these swimsuits.  As much as they look great as part of everyday wear you can also swim in them!  But take care to wash them well after swimming because lycra doesn’t like saltwater and chlorine!  Also note that these don’t have the crotch fastenings.

I have so much fun styling these up for playing around with different outfits to complement the bodysuit. With a printed one, like the one above, I go for simple items to go with it such as plain shorts and cardigans so as not to complicate the outfit. I would wear this with a mini skirt, tight jeans, or some little denim shorts. It would also go with some baggy pants to give the effect of baggy bottom, tight top. It might also go with some leggings over the top but to do this I think would take some careful styling. Then I might put a nice cardigan or blazer over the top if it’s a cold day. It looks even better with a nice low hanging necklace too!
